Ireland is a small island nation located to the west of the UK that is a tourist attraction in and of itself. With a legendary history and addictive social atmosphere that has influenced European travel for decades, there are many attractions to visit when in Ireland. Blarney Castle in Cork and the Rock of Cashel in Munster are two legendary and popular attractions that always secure a spot on any Irish vacation. If you can only visit one, which is better: Blarney Castle or Rock of Cashel?

In terms of overall things to do and sights to see, you will likely have a more well-rounded experience when visiting the Rock of Cashel. Blarney Castle has become more of a novelty attraction with its famous Blarney Stone, but there isn’t much more to see after visiting the popular stone.

Conclusion: Blarney Castle or Rock of Cashel?

When it comes down to which of these two popular attractions is worth visiting in this comparison, the choice is difficult. Both areas of Ireland offer many of the same types of experiences.

Blarney Castle has the legendary Blarney Stone on the grounds, which is said to give a person the gift of eloquence once you kiss the stone. For this reason, a trip to Blarney Castle marks an Irish rite of passage.
